Hi all, really good job!

I would like to see a "scale" in the toolbar of vncterm windows (to scale at 25%, 50%, 75%, etc.)
I found myself dealing with extra-large windows when working with KVM.

For some strange reasons I have some virtual machines running on KVM and screen are too large (i.e 1440x900) for my laptop (1366x768)
when I work from linux there's no problem: I can move window.
But when working from Windows is a nightmare, I can't see bottom of vncterm screen.

Scaling vncterm content (as you can do in tightvnc or ultravnc viewers) would improve user experience's when working with KVM virtual machines.
